I purchased childrens coloring books at the Dollar Store and transferred the patterns onto solid quilting fabric blocks that I pre-cut. You don't have to limit yourself to just using white. It works with light pastels also. They make darling juvenille quilts. I ordered transfer pens to trace and transfer the pictures. Then I outlined everything with a black pigma permanent ink pen. Then colored and use a heavy layer of crayon. I purchased blank "Doodle Pads" from the Dollar Store to use for heat setting. Don't use a sheet more than once or you will have a mess.
